I'm going to be running a 62" Minn-Kota Rip Tide 24 volt 80 lb. bow mount on my 22' Islander that I've converted into a center-console. Unfortunately I haven't been able to test it yet. But after taking measurements from a few other rigs I think it should work fine. Once spring rolls around I will know how it works.
